Madison, WI, May, 20, 2015βWisconsin Bank & Trust (WBT) invites the public to open house events May 26-29, in celebration of its merger with Community Bank & Trust. The open houses will feature refreshments, giveaways, contests, and promotions. Events will take place at the following banking centers, formerly Community Bank & Trust branches:
- 4131 West Loomis Road, Ste. 100, Greenfield, WI 53221; 414-281-5535
- 5380 North Port Washington Road, Glendale, WI 53217; 414-967-9880

About Wisconsin Bank & Trust
Wisconsin Bank & Trust (WBT) is a community bank with assets of more than $1.0 billion, serving customers in the Madison, Monroe, Green Bay, Sheboygan and southwest areas of Wisconsin. The bank is a subsidiary of Heartland Financial USA, Inc. [NASDAQ: HTLF] and operates 19 banking centers and two mortgage origination offices, all located in Wisconsin.
